Improved handling for new invoices

This commit is contained in:
2026-04-18 23:42:39 +02:00
parent 33a9271013
commit 4878f750bd
16 changed files with 206 additions and 32 deletions

View File

@@ -25,9 +25,10 @@ const props = defineProps({
userIban: String,
havePassengers: Number,
materialTransportation: Boolean,
travelReason: String,
})
console.log(props.receipt)
console.log(props)
const finalStep = ref(true)
const userName = ref(props.userName)
@@ -49,6 +50,8 @@ async function sendData() {
errorMsg.value = ''
success.value = false
console.log(props)
const formData = new FormData()
formData.append('name', userName.value)
@@ -61,6 +64,7 @@ async function sendData() {
formData.append('accountIban', userIban.value)
formData.append('havePassengers', props.havePassengers ? 1 : 0)
formData.append('materialTransportation', props.materialTransportation ? 1 : 0)
formData.append('travelReason', props.travelReason)
if (props.receipt) {
formData.append('receipt', props.receipt)